How can I use my accepted tax refund to invest in cryptocurrencies?
I recently received my tax refund and I'm interested in investing it in cryptocurrencies. How can I go about using my tax refund to invest in digital currencies? What are the steps involved and what platforms or exchanges should I consider?
3 answers
- Espersen SargentMay 14, 2023 · 3 years agoSure, using your tax refund to invest in cryptocurrencies can be a great way to potentially grow your money. Here's a step-by-step guide to help you get started: 1. Choose a cryptocurrency exchange: Research and select a reputable cryptocurrency exchange that supports the cryptocurrencies you're interested in. Some popular exchanges include Coinbase, Binance, and Kraken. 2. Create an account: Sign up for an account on the chosen exchange. This usually involves providing your email address, creating a password, and completing any necessary identity verification procedures. 3. Deposit your tax refund: Once your account is set up, navigate to the deposit section and choose the option to deposit funds. Follow the instructions provided to deposit your tax refund into your exchange account. 4. Choose your cryptocurrencies: Decide which cryptocurrencies you want to invest in. Conduct thorough research and consider factors such as market trends, project fundamentals, and risk tolerance. 5. Place your investment order: On the exchange platform, locate the trading section and place an order to buy the desired cryptocurrencies using your deposited funds. 6. Secure your investment: After purchasing cryptocurrencies, it's crucial to transfer them to a secure wallet that you control. Hardware wallets like Ledger or Trezor offer enhanced security. Remember, investing in cryptocurrencies carries risks, so it's important to do your due diligence and only invest what you can afford to lose. Good luck with your investment journey!
